EPA v. Rayne, City of
Unilateral Administrative Order Without Adjudication
Case summary
VIOLATION: Facility violatedSection 301of the Act, 33 U.S.C. � 1311, with bypasses from June 2002 through April 2003. RELIEF: Due to lack of funding resources, the best we can expect is replacement of NW Rayne collection system by Dec 2003 and E Rayne collection system,pump station, and force main project by Jan 2005. By June 2006, select Phase II project based on evaluation of system and submit a final plan to EPA.
